Transpiration refers specifically to the process by which plants lose water vapor to the atmosphere, primarily through small openings in their leaves called stomata. This process is critical for plants as it enables them to regulate their temperature, control gas exchange, and facilitate the movement of nutrients and water from the roots through the plant.

Understanding that transpiration is essentially about the evaporation of water from the plant into the air helps clarify its importance in both plant physiology and the broader ecosystem.
